A new sequential filtering algorithm that incorporates the radial velocity measurement into Kalman filter in the presence of correlated range and radial velocity measurement errors is presented. An analysis is given about its asymptotic behavior on the basis of the analysis of the stochastic controllability and observability. The simulation results verify the analysis and show that the new algorithm is superior to the conventional extended Kalman filter (EKF) and close to an ideal filter.
